Meeting notes – Records team sync, excerpt

Quick recap on the contract shuttle: signed originals now move between the Elmsgate and Torvale offices every Thursday, not ad hoc. Bren will prep the sealed folder by noon; Odette books the courier slot. Nothing leaves the registry without a tracking entry. For the actual hand-over to the courier, stick to this:

handover note for yagef-bagep: the drudor pelius courier leaves the kasdor zorvan norir ledger at gate 8016 under passcode 755406

Alert: RestockPlannerLagHigh. The Coppervend restock planner has fallen more than 20 minutes behind schedule generating route plans. Plugin authors should expect stale inventory snapshots and delayed webhook deliveries until the backlog clears; retries are safe and idempotent. No action is needed on your side unless the alert persists past one hour. Current status and backlog depth are published on the internal status page.

operations page: https://jira.tolvaqlabs.internal/projects/display/display/4a61db70

Ticket: DeployBot env misconfig on Harrowgate staging.

The deploy-status chat bot posts to the wrong room because staging copied prod's channel map. Reviewer: check the diff only touches the staging overlay. Channel routing is fixed in this patch; bot auth was never set at all, which is why it silently dropped messages. The bot's messaging credential goes on the line below.

secret setting of kajep-tagep: VAULT_KEY5=e66ae

# PixelRinse client setup.
# Strips EXIF (GPS, serial, timestamps) from all release screenshots
# before they hit the Lumenbay CDN. Runs in the publish pipeline only.
# Do NOT skip scrubbing for hotfix builds — compliance checks will fail.
# Client needs the internal scrub-service credential; it's scoped to
# write-only on the staging bucket and rotates quarterly.
# Current key for this cycle is below.

service key, tadup-tahog: zpat7_wB1tnEL